>>>>>> Reject NL80211_CMD_DISCONNECT, NL80211_CMD_DISASSOCIATE,
>>>>>> NL80211_CMD_DEAUTHENTICATE and NL80211_CMD_ASSOCIATE commands
>>>>>> from clients other than the connection owner set in the connect,
>>>>>> authenticate or associate commands, if it was set.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> The main point of this check is to prevent chaos when two processes
>>>>>> try to use nl80211 at the same time, it's not a security measure.
>>>>>> The same thing should possibly be done for JOIN_IBSS/LEAVE_IBSS and
>>>>>> START_AP/STOP_AP.

>> Do we really want this? Is the referred chaos hypothetical or an actual
>> issue. Nothing stops me from doing an 'ifconfig down' so why should 'iw
>> disconnect' be any different. As far I can tell it does not affect my
>> testing environment, but particularly in such use-cases I can expect
>> issues adopting this change, which is also hypothetical of course ;-)
>
> Yeah, it's a good question. But it might help with inadvertent issues,
> like starting wpa_s which immediately disconnects if it finds something
> connected. If that fails, perhaps you have a better chance of noticing
> the error?
Sure. I guess we all have been there kicking of wpa_s and discovering
there is already one running in the background. I am just a bit
squeamish to change the behavior like this. Hmmmm. Is wpa_s already
using SOCKET_OWNER. If so, I might create a patch to opt-out for that so
people can knowingly choose chaos ;-)
